What Happened to Customer Service?

Is it just me or have you also noticed a big increase in poor customer service (in the U.S.)?   It almost seems as if our society and culture is accepting this kind of behavior.  Here are some situations that I come across quite too often:

  • Cashiers or order-takers that have personal conversations on the phone or with co-workers while they have waiting customers.
  • Sales people who are rude and talk-back to customers.
  • Workers that don’t take their jobs seriously – which results in half-ass work.

I think there are some obvious reasons for this negative trend:

  • As our economy declines, companies are paying less to its employees.  And with lower wages, workers don’t take their jobs as seriously.
  • Our society/culture accepts this type of behavior.  Remember the days when we used to have respect for our elders and strangers.  Well, not anymore.  Now, our kids grow up with the mentality that it’s not cool to be nice to people.  Customer service is more deeply rooted than simple personal attitude – it goes as far as childhood up-bringing.
  • Poor management leads to poor employees.  Why would workers give a rat’s ass about the company if the owner or managers don’t either?
  • Lack of discipline.  Some people don’t know how to separate work from personal issues.  When your problems from home start affecting your work performance, then something needs to be done.

So…how does this affect the businesses providing the poor customer service?

  • Loss of customers.
  • Bad reputation.
  • Negative workplace morale.
  • Eventually, a failed business.

Businesses need to keep in mind that customers are the life-blood of their business.  Without customers, there is no money.  Without money, there is no business.
